MAMMILLA n.
The nipple.
MAMMILLARY a. 2 definitions
Of or pertaining to the mammilla, or nipple, or to the breast; resembling a mammilla; mammilloid.
MAMMILLATE; MAMMILLATED a. 2 definitions
Having small nipples, or small protuberances like nipples or mammæ.

LIMONITE n.
Hydrous sesquixoide of iron, an important ore of iron, occurring in stalactitic, mammillary, or earthy forms, of a dark brown color, yellowish brown powder. It includes bog iron. Also called brown hematite.
MALACHITE n.
Native hydrous carbonate of copper, usually occurring in green mammillary masses with concentric fibrous structure.

MAMMILLIFORM a.
Having the form of a mammilla.
MAMMILLOID a.
Like a mammilla or nipple; mammilliform.
METAPOPHYSIS n.
A tubercle projecting from the anterior articular processes of some vertebræ; a mammillary process.
NIPPLE n.
The protuberance through which milk is drawn from the breast or mamma; the mammilla; a teat; a pap.
PAP n.
A nipple; a mammilla; a teat. Dryden. The paps which thou hast sucked. Luke xi. 27.
PREHNITE n.
A pale green mineral occurring in crystalline aggregates having a botryoidal or mammillary structure, and rarely in distinct crystals. It is a hydrous silicate of alumina and lime.
